public class SoClosingBallByReconstructionProcessing3d extends SoImageVizEngine
SoClosingBallByReconstructionProcessing3dengine. TheSoClosingBallByReconstructionProcessing3dperforms a 3D closing by reconstruction using a structuring element matching with a ball.A closing by reconstruction consists in applying a dilation followed by a morphological reconstruction. In the binary case a closing by reconstruction can be used for filling small holes without modifying edges of the objects. In the grayscale case closing by reconstruction can be used for performing a Top Hat by reconstruction which allows to detect dark small structures without getting artifacts from the boundary concavities of large structures.
This command supports two modes:
- A fast mode which approximates a circular structuring element by combining dilations and erosions using 6, 18 and 26 neighborhoods.
 - A precise mode (slower) which ensures a real circular structuring element.

Field Detail
- 
inImage
public final SoSFImageDataAdapter inImage
Input image. Default value is NULL. Supported types include: grayscale binary label image. 
- 
elementSize
public final SoSFInt32 elementSize
Ball's radius. Default value is 3. 
- 
precisionMode
public final SoSFEnum<SoClosingBallByReconstructionProcessing3d.PrecisionModes> precisionMode
Precision for computation method. . Default is FASTER 
- 
outImage
public final SoImageVizEngineOutput<SoSFImageDataAdapter,SoImageDataAdapter> outImage
Output image. Default value is NULL. Supported types include: grayscale binary label image.
